Transaction 6195fef5975042388cfcee849a712a4057132866040edfce45380f7434d932a5

1 Input
2 Outputs
  • 6195fef5975042388cfcee849a712a4057132866040edfce45380f7434d932a5:0
  • value  1980198
    address  2ND5sPrfhXkUGtFW2GG4QfDr8cWfmdq54Fw
  • 6195fef5975042388cfcee849a712a4057132866040edfce45380f7434d932a5:1
  • value  726142074
    address  2MxxGNq4GczbjWAni7MU6np55YA8gw6DyGX